Devon Darlin' 11 Luxury Wooden Rowing Dinghy Yacht Tender
The Devon Darlin’ 11 is an amphibious rowing tender that really turns heads, whether stationary in the dinghy park or on the slipway at the club as you come in, step out and keep walking with the boat at your side; no more wondering who has used your launching trolley or where they have left it this time.
Built using the finest Mahogany and Sapele Marine plywood’s along with Utile Mahogany and Sitka Spruce, and even the oars are laminated with a Mahogany centre and Douglas Fir outer, and then hand-shaped. The whole boat is glued using West System Epoxy. We finish the boat with SP System wood protection and Epifanes 2-part polyurethane paints and varnish, enabling regular use while maintaining the quality of the finish.
This boat has seen very little use, as it was used as a showpiece; it really is a work of art! However, it also rows beautifully, and is incredibly stable!
It could do with a polish, or fresh coat of varnish on the inside, hence the low price.
